Lee Bum-Soo is a 35-year-old football player who plays as a keeper for Gyeongnam FC, born on 10 de dezembro de 1990. Follow Lee Bum-Soo on FotMob for live match updates, detailed statistics, career history, transfer news, FotMob ratings, and comprehensive performance analytics.

In the 2025 K-League 2 season, Lee Bum-Soo has recorded 90 minutes, an average FotMob rating of 7.66.

Lee Bum-Soo scores highly on Conceded and Rating compared to keepers in the K-League 2.

Lee Bum-Soo's career has also included time at Incheon United, Bucheon FC 1995, Jeonbuk Hyundai Motors FC, Gangwon FC, Gyeongnam FC, Daejeon Hana Citizen, and Seoul E-Land FC.

Throughout their career, Lee Bum-Soo has won 5 titles: K League 2 (2025) with Incheon United, K League 2 (2017) with Gyeongnam FC, and K League 1 (2014, 2011) and Cup (2022) with Jeonbuk Hyundai Motors FC.
